Tibetan Communities and Buddhist Culture Around Pokhara

  • Visit Tibetan refugee settlements around Pokhara Valley and discover how Tibetan people live in Nepal and how they have kept their Tibetan language, identity, and Buddhist culture intact. Learn about the meanings of Buddhist signs and symbols such as prayer wheels, flags, stupas, and more.
  • Learn about the life of Buddhist monks by visiting a Buddhist monastery. Discover their monastic education and daily routines, and experience a Buddhist monk chanting a prayer.
  • Explore Tibetan schools and the education system in the Tibetan settlements.
  • Step inside a Tibetan carpet showroom and immerse yourself in Tibet's rich culture and artistry. It is the perfect place to discover the fascinating history and process behind the creation of Tibetan carpets. Your knowledgeable guide will take you through the entire process of making carpets, from the selection of raw sheep wool to the finished products. As you explore the showroom, you will see an impressive collection of carpets in various colours, sizes, and designs. You are welcome to take pictures and touch the carpets to fully appreciate the intricate artistry involved in creating each piece.
  • Visit a photo gallery and learn about the establishment of Tibetan settlements in Pokhara in the early 1960s through various photos of Tibetan people and their culture.
  • Meet a Tibetan doctor and learn about Tibetan medicine, diagnosis, and treatment. You will even receive a first-hand experience with a medical check-up from a Tibetan doctor.
  • Enjoy Tibetan food by savoring simple and delicious dishes in Tibetan restaurants, such as momos and Thenthuk, and learn how these foods were first introduced in Nepal.
  • See a beautiful Buddhist monastery and meet a young Buddhist monk to learn about the monastic lifestyle, daily studies, and activities in the monastery.
  • Attend the evening group pooja (prayer chanting) with the monks and experience the vibration and energy of the chanting. Hear the horns, drums, conch shell, trumpet, bell, and other instruments used during the prayer.
  • Taste traditional Tibetan snacks with a local family and experience the flavour of Tibetan food, such as Tsampa (roasted barley flour), butter tea, and Tibetan bread.
